物流行业作为现代经济的“血液”,其效率直接影响着全球供应链的运作。随着科技的飞速发展,物流行业正在经历一场深刻的变革。本文将探讨如何通过技术创新和运营优化,实现货物运输的高效和智能化。
一、智能化运输管理
1.1 物联网技术
物联网(IoT)的应用是物流行业智能化的基础。通过在运输工具和货物上安装传感器,可以实时监控货物的位置、状态和运输过程中的环境因素。
示例代码:
# 假设有一个用于监控货物的传感器数据接口
class SensorData:
def __init__(self, temperature, humidity, location):
self.temperature = temperature
self.humidity = humidity
self.location = location
def get_data(self):
return {
"temperature": self.temperature,
"humidity": self.humidity,
"location": self.location
}
# 获取传感器数据
sensor = SensorData(25, 50, "Beijing")
data = sensor.get_data()
print(data)
1.2 车辆路线优化
利用人工智能算法,如机器学习中的路径规划算法,可以实现车辆路线的优化,减少运输时间和成本。
示例代码:
import numpy as np
import matplotlib.pyplot as plt
# 创建一个简单的地图
map_size = (10, 10)
map = np.zeros(map_size)
# 设置障碍物
obstacles = [(1, 1), (1, 2), (2, 1), (2, 2)]
for obstacle in obstacles:
map[obstacle] = 1
# 绘制地图
plt.imshow(map, cmap='binary')
plt.colorbar()
plt.show()
二、自动化仓储管理
2.1 自动化设备
自动化仓储系统包括自动存储和检索系统(AS/RS),机器人拣选系统等,可以显著提高仓储效率。
示例代码:
# 假设有一个自动存储和检索系统的简单模型
class AutomatedStorageSystem:
def __init__(self, capacity):
self.capacity = capacity
self.storage = {}
def store(self, item, location):
if len(self.storage) < self.capacity:
self.storage[location] = item
return True
return False
def retrieve(self, location):
return self.storage.pop(location, None)
# 创建自动化仓储系统
storage_system = AutomatedStorageSystem(100)
storage_system.store("item1", "A1")
item = storage_system.retrieve("A1")
print(item)
2.2 仓库管理系统(WMS)
WMS系统可以实时监控仓库库存,优化库存管理,减少库存积压。
示例代码:
# 假设有一个简单的仓库管理系统
class WarehouseManagementSystem:
def __init__(self):
self.inventory = {}
def add_item(self, item, quantity):
if item in self.inventory:
self.inventory[item] += quantity
else:
self.inventory[item] = quantity
def remove_item(self, item, quantity):
if item in self.inventory and self.inventory[item] >= quantity:
self.inventory[item] -= quantity
else:
raise ValueError("Insufficient quantity")
# 创建仓库管理系统
wms = WarehouseManagementSystem()
wms.add_item("item1", 100)
wms.remove_item("item1", 50)
print(wms.inventory)
三、绿色物流
3.1 可持续包装
使用可降解材料,减少包装废弃物,是绿色物流的重要组成部分。
示例代码:
# 假设有一个用于检测包装材料是否可降解的函数
def is_degradable(material):
degradable_materials = ["paper", "biodegradable plastic", "cardboard"]
return material in degradable_materials
# 检测包装材料
material = "biodegradable plastic"
print(is_degradable(material))
3.2 节能运输
采用节能运输工具和优化运输路线,减少能源消耗和碳排放。
示例代码:
# 假设有一个用于计算运输路线能耗的函数
def calculate_energy_consumption(distance, vehicle_efficiency):
return distance * vehicle_efficiency
# 计算能耗
distance = 1000 # 公里
vehicle_efficiency = 0.1 # 单位:千米/升
energy_consumption = calculate_energy_consumption(distance, vehicle_efficiency)
print(f"Energy consumption: {energy_consumption} liters")
四、总结
物流行业的变革是一个复杂而持续的过程,需要技术创新和运营优化的双重驱动。通过智能化运输管理、自动化仓储管理、绿色物流等措施,物流行业可以实现货物运输的高效和智能化,为经济发展提供有力支撑。
